infantry    音标拼音: ['ɪnfəntri]
n. 步兵,步兵团

步兵,步兵团

infantry
n 1: an army unit consisting of soldiers who fight on foot;
"there came ten thousand horsemen and as many fully-armed
foot" [synonym: {infantry}, {foot}]
